Sustainability Pioneers 7: From Paris to New York

Few U.S. states are actively transforming their economies to meet climate goals aligned with the Paris Agreement. The "Sustainability Pioneers" series showcases New York as a leader in bold climate action. Its "Reforming the Energy Vision" policy targets 50% clean energy by 2030.

The episode also explores grassroots energy transitions at Eco Village At Ithaca and Hunt Country Vineyards in the Finger Lakes. (Published March 17, 2016)

Sustainability Pioneers 5: Becoming Energy Independent

Germany's Climate Community Saerbeck, a town of 7,000, offers a global model for sustainable energy independence. Starting climate work in 2009, it produced more renewable energy than it consumed within five years.

Sustainability Pioneers interviews Ralf Fuecks (Heinrich Boll Foundation president) and climate scientist Neil Donahue (Carnegie Mellon University). They discuss carbon footprint reduction and its feasibility in the U.S.

Sustainability Pioneers 4: It Takes a Leader

The "Doomsday Clock" stands at three minutes to midnight, reflecting the climate crisis as a threat to humanity as serious as nuclear weapons. While world leaders have largely failed to act, some, like Monaca, Pennsylvania's Borough Manager Mario Leone, Jr., are modeling solutions. Through Mr. Leone's energy-saving strategies, Monaca has reduced utility costs by 25 percent.

Sustainability Pioneers 3: It Takes a Village

Sustainability Pioneers' film, "It Takes a Village," highlights the power of community. Filmmaker Kirsi Jansa visits Butler, Pennsylvania, and Balcombe, UK, where residents are envisioning alternative futures amidst ongoing fossil fuel development.

Sustainability Pioneers 2: From Haze to Sun

Part 2 of Sustainability Pioneers features companies building a bridge to a renewable energy future. It highlights WindStax Wind Power Systems, which designs and manufactures unique plug-and-play wind power systems for residential and commercial off-grid, microgrid, and supplemental power requirements.

Sustainability Pioneers 1: The Journey Begins

Sustainability Pioneers is a documentary series exploring the transition to sustainable energy. It investigates 2014 energy production in Pennsylvania and its impact on air, climate, and public health.

The Thinking Game | Full documentary | Tribeca Film Festival official selection

“The Thinking Game” is the inside story of DeepMind's groundbreaking AI research, culminating in the Nobel Prize-winning AlphaFold breakthrough. Filmed over five years by the award-winning team behind "AlphaGo," this documentary explores co-founder Demis Hassabis's lifelong pursuit of artificial general intelligence and the rigorous scientific journey from mastering strategy games to solving the 50-year-old protein folding problem.
